Training & Experience
As an Integrative Arts Child Therapist, I am able to work in a way that is responsive to each child and their own needs, rather than using a single approach for all.
I draw on a number of theories and traditions of therapeutic work including: Art Therapy, Attachment Theory, Play Therapy and Person-Centred approaches. I like working systemically and enjoy strengthening relationships between parent(s) and child(ren).
I am registered with BACP and I work within their ethical framework as a Therapist.
